Captain’s Report 6

ESCA Division 7, Match 6: Peebles CCC vs Murrayfield DAFS, Saturday 1st June 2024.

Last Saturday Peebles County welcomed Murrayfield DAFS down to Whitestone Park on what turned out to be the warmest weekend of the year.

Skipper Caddick won the toss (again) and County went out to bat first with Chris Richardson (0) and Caddick (19) opening the innings. Nick Jenkins (12) was the immovable object as County looked to remain in the game early but found run scoring difficult in the long outfield with some accurate bowling. County welcomed season debuts to Adam Hayward (1), Neil Cummings (dnb) and Ian Price (1*) as DAFS kept the runs down at drinks. Zeeshan Gohar (17) continued his good form this season and Niall Burns (6) struck a mighty blow out towards Cardrona. Darren Gray (13) enjoyed a longer stay at the wicket and Aarad Ajmal (0) perished quickly. County got to 83 at tea with just Neil Cummings and Lawrence Dritsas not batting.

DAFS and County have shared many games and a few players have moved south between the clubs, so an enjoyable tea was had with a few cricket stories before County went out to field. The skipper encouraged tight bowling and with a few wickets and slow outfield county were still in the game. Burns (0-15) and Ajmal (1-26) opened the bowling before Hayward (0-29) and Gray (0-14) took over. Ajmal bowled the young DAFS opener but that was the only breakthrough as DAFS reached the target with overs to spare.

Player of the match went to the returning Neil Cummings keeping wicket tidily today. Champagne moment shared between Burns and Gray for some surprising and comical running between the wickets that was slower than stop with both requiring energy bars and shakes (Paris Olympics beware!).  Well played to DAFS and a game played in an enjoyable fashion with County calling back a batsmen following the cricket laws for a double hit.
